diff --git a/misc/py-einops/Makefile b/misc/py-einops/Makefile index 3842dba6dae6..a6ce6c65d9cc 100644 --- a/misc/py-einops/Makefile +++ b/misc/py-einops/Makefile @@ -1,35 +1,35 @@ PORTNAME= einops DISTVERSIONPREFIX= v -DISTVERSION= 0.7.0 +DISTVERSION= 0.8.0 CATEGORIES= misc # machine-learning #MASTER_SITES= PYPI # some test files are missing in the PYPI tarball P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X} MAINTAINER= yuri@FreeBSD.org COMMENT= New flavour of deep learning operations WWW= https://einops.rocks/ LICENSE= MIT LICENSE_FILE= ${WRKSRC}/LICENSE BUILD_DEPENDS= ${PYTHON_PKGNAMEPREFIX}hatchling>=1.10.0:devel/py-hatchling@${PY_FLAVOR} TEST_DEPENDS= ${PYTHON_PKGNAMEPREFIX}nbconvert>0:devel/py-nbconvert@${PY_FLAVOR} \ ${PYTHON_PKGNAMEPREFIX}parameterized>0:devel/py-parameterized@${PY_FLAVOR} \ ${PYTHON_PKGNAMEPREFIX}pytorch>0:misc/py-pytorch@${PY_FLAVOR} USES= python USE_PYTHON= pep517 autoplist pytest # 5 tests fail because of some pytorch issues, see https://github.com/arogozhnikov/einops/issues/313 USE_GITHUB= yes GH_ACCOUNT= arogozhnikov NO_ARCH= yes BINARY_ALIAS= python=${PYTHON_CMD} TEST_ENV= ${MAKE_ENV} EINOPS_TEST_BACKENDS="numpy,torch" do-test-via-script: @cd ${WRKSRC} && ${SETENV} ${TEST_ENV} ${PYTHON_CMD} test.py numpy pytorch .include diff --git a/misc/py-einops/distinfo b/misc/py-einops/distinfo index a27253bb09c4..ebdda43b4f60 100644 --- a/misc/py-einops/distinfo +++ b/misc/py-einops/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1712160733 -SHA256 (arogozhnikov-einops-v0.7.0_GH0.tar.gz) = ed66c35ac0f9db466352c27d2ae9a9504d592a2c2c552dca58e57baa630c99a6 -SIZE (arogozhnikov-einops-v0.7.0_GH0.tar.gz) = 384051 +TIMESTAMP = 1714370387 +SHA256 (arogozhnikov-einops-v0.8.0_GH0.tar.gz) = 375c91d19ef91eb9456aef3bd536ffa0b3d3841081bf8f8011eaee00c2511bed +SIZE (arogozhnikov-einops-v0.8.0_GH0.tar.gz) = 383693